3.Airfares set to rise as Centre hikes airport charges :-

Airfares are set to go up as the government has decided to raise airport charges across all non-major airports operated by Airports Authority of India (AAI) by 5% every year beginning April 1.

 

4.In tit-for-tat, Iran imposes curbs on 15 U.S. firms :-

Iran said on Sunday that it has imposed sanctions on 15 American companies over their alleged support for Israel, terrorism and repression in the region.

 

5.HAL finalises major plan to speed up aircraft production :-

State-run aerospace behemoth Hindustan Aeronautics Limited (HAL) has finalised a major plan to manufacture nearly 1,000 military helicopters and over a hundred planes, in tune with government’s focus on speeding up defence indigenisation.

7.Kerala Transport Minister Saseendran quits after TV exposé :-

Kerala Transport Minister A.K. Saseendran resigned on Sunday, just hours after a newly launched Malayalam news channel aired an audio clip in which he was alleged to have engaged in a lewd phone conversation with a woman.

 

8.Hong Kong chooses first woman head :-

A Beijing-backed civil servant, Carrie Lam, was chosen to be Hong Kong’s next leader on Sunday amid accusations that Beijing is meddling and denying the financial hub a more populist leader perhaps better able to defuse the political tension.
